Powhatan State Park offers easy access to the James River with popular kayaking and tubing options, riverside benches, and varied woodland trails. The family-friendly park includes a playground and well-maintained campsites that are large, tree-shaded and fairly private, with water and electric at many sites. Bathhouses, showers and laundry are reported clean. Cell service is generally good. Trails are mostly gentle but a few routes have steep sections that may challenge those with limited mobility. Expect a peaceful, scenic visit, though occasional distant road or train noise and a few uneven sites are possible tradeoffs.

- Boating and Fishing: The park features three car-top boat slides for river access, accommodating activities like canoeing, kayaking, and fishing. Anglers can expect to catch various fish species in the James River.
- Trails: Over 12 miles of multi-use trails are available for hiking, biking, and horseback riding, traversing diverse landscapes and offering wildlife observation opportunities.
- Camping: Facilities include a full-service campground with electric and water hookups, a primitive canoe-in/hike-in campground, and a group campground, catering to different camping preferences.
- Picnicking and Playgrounds: Designated picnic areas equipped with shelters and a playground are available for family-friendly activities.
- Hours: The park is open daily from dawn to dusk.
